Better data needed to tackle rising nat cat challenges in Asia: Perils

Asia-Pacific is experiencing an alarming increase in weather events, in both their frequency and severity. This escalation calls for better data to effectively address the complex challenges confronting the region, Darryl Pidcock, head of Perils in Asia-Pacific, told Intelligent Insurer.
